Suggest a better descriptionWhisk vinegar, mustard, garlic, oregano and thyme to blend. Slowly whisk in olive oil. Stir in olives and season to taste with salt and pepper.
Place hens or chicken pieces in seal-able plastic ban and pour in marinade. Seal and refrigerate several hours or overnight
Transfer to foil-lined baking sheet. Pour marinade remaining in bag over hens/chicken. Bake at 375 degrees about 45 minutes or until done.
